This is a set of four British antique silver-plated napkin rings, featuring a rounded, barrel-shaped form adorned with intricate hand-engraving..
Within the wreath on the front, the numbers "1" through "4" are proudly engraved, while delicate botanical patterns reminiscent of ferns and ginkgo leaves spread gracefully around them. It is a design with profound charm that reflects the influence of Japonisme and the Aesthetic Movement that flourished in late 19th-century Britain.
